Output d59861386e1565f1dbc004ef57be3cc8ad0e91f02f37a9779d34f4ec808ca5f5:7

value
1090729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 096d1face425676c67616bea4a6ba6d853754798 OP_EQUAL
address
32YrjKWsCprgmPDoeqh87WZL658F22EyYB
transaction
d59861386e1565f1dbc004ef57be3cc8ad0e91f02f37a9779d34f4ec808ca5f5
confirmations
296703
spent
true